(Bloomberg) -- The appearance of SiTime Corp. components in the new iPhone 16e is fueling a stock rally for the little-known chipmaker, sending the shares up 20% on Wednesday.

A device teardown of the smartphone by TechInsights revealed the existence of timer chips from SiTime, a maker of clock components that had about $200 million in revenue last year.
